NFIB’s Elizabeth Milito spoke on small business struggles with one-size-fits-all mandates
U.S. Senate Finance Committee Hears Testimony on Paid Leave Mandates
- leave mandates impede flexibility, which is the key to making small businesses the “employers of choice” in our communities,
- leave mandates impose inordinate complexity and costs on small businesses, and
- leave mandates lead to death by a thousand mandates.
